The Twin Cities 7 with Charmin Michelle: Veteran local vocalist teams up with a Count Basie-inspired septet. (4 p.m.)
Francisco Mela & Cuban Safari: A superb Cuban-born drummer and member of Joe Lovano's Us 5 brings the quintet responsible for last year's superb Cuban-jazz fusion album "Tree of Life." (6 p.m.)
Delfeayo Marsalis: The most underrated of the Marsalis clan, trombonist/arranger Delfeayo brings an octet with saxophonist Mark Gross and drummer Winard Harper for an ambitious program from the disc "Sweet Thunder," which expands upon Duke Ellington's musical portraits of characters from the works of William Shakespeare. (8:30 p.m.)
Araya Orta Latin Jazz Quartet: Two pairs of brothers, the Arayas and the Ortas, play a rich Latin-jazz mix from Miami by way of Costa Rica. (4 p.m.)
Luca Ciarla: This Italian violinist, arriving with a bassist and accordionist, should set an intriguing, intrepid mood in advance of the Bad Plus. (6 p.m.)
The Bad Plus with Joshua Redman: Two high-profile jazz acts in collaboration. Redman is a rollicking tenor most recently in James Farm and the SFJazz Collective. (8:30 p.m.)
